      Arithmetic math may seem simple, but its impact is profound. By combining basic operations in various ways, individuals can solve complex calculations with ease. For instance, breaking down a large calculation into smaller, manageable parts can make it more accessible and less overwhelming. This is achieved by applying the order of operations, which dictates the sequence in which mathematical operations should be performed. By mastering this fundamental concept, individuals can tackle even the most daunting calculations with confidence.
